Book Description

May 22, 1987
Nobody will believe Tom when he tells them that he has seen a lion - especially when he says it was padding through the orchard with a string of sausages hanging from its mouth. So Tom sits up, night after night, waiting for the lion to return.

About the Author

Michael Morpurgo is one of today's most popular and critically acclaimed children's writers, author of KENSUKE'S KINGDOM and THE WRECK OF THE ZANZIBAR amongst many other titles. He has won a multitude of prizes including the Children's Book Award, the Smarties Prize and the Writer's Guild Award. --This text refers to an out of print or unavailable edition of this title.

From AudioFile

Poor Tom! No one will believe him when he says he's seen a lion carrying a string of sausages! This charming short story perfectly captures the feelings of a child whom everyone refuses to believe. Narrator Philip Jackson captures Tom's despair, his parents' frustration, and Tom's exhilaration when Clare, his classmate, agrees with him. Clare, the smartest girl in Tom's class, hatches a bold plan that Tom bravely sets into motion to prove that he's not a liar. Young listeners will be awe-struck by the lion and will identify with Tom's situation.
